** The Lexus repair market for the Climax, Colorado area is entirely reliant on shops in neighboring towns like Leadville, Frisco, and Buena Vista. Due to the remote, high-altitude location and the affluent nature of the surrounding communities (e.g., Breckenridge, Vail), the market is characterized by a moderate level of competition among a small number of high-quality, independent specialists. These shops must be equipped to handle the unique challenges of high-altitude engine performance, harsh winter driving conditions (impacting AWD systems and suspensions), and the complex electronics of luxury vehicles. **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, as shops in this region cater to a clientele with expensive vehicles and high expectations. They must invest in ongoing technician training and advanced diagnostic tools.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are not a large number of shops, the ones that exist are established and competent. There are no Lexus dealerships in the immediate area, creating a strong niche for qualified independents.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is premium, reflecting the cost of specialized training, high-quality parts, and the operational expenses of running a business in a mountain community. Labor rates are typically 15-25% higher than in major metropolitan areas like Denver.
